      <description>&lt;P&gt;I have been trying to get predicted probability for each count. I am putting code "predicted=" after model statement but that is giving me the mean of poisson. How can I get predicted probability based on poisson for each count and graph it?&lt;/P&gt;&lt;P&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;data world;&lt;BR /&gt;input scores @@;&lt;BR /&gt;datalines;&lt;BR /&gt;4 3 3 3 2 4 2 0 3 3 3 2 4 2&lt;BR /&gt;1 1 1 3 7 3 2 2 2 5&lt;/P&gt;&lt;P&gt;..........&lt;BR /&gt;;&lt;/P&gt;&lt;P&gt;proc genmod data=world;&lt;BR /&gt;model scores= /dist=poisson link=log;&lt;BR /&gt;&lt;STRONG&gt;output out=new predicted=predictedscores;&lt;/STRONG&gt;&lt;BR /&gt;run;&lt;BR /&gt;quit;&lt;/P&gt;</description>

      <description>&lt;P&gt;If you have a SAS/ETS license, &lt;STRONG&gt;proc countreg&lt;/STRONG&gt; provides option &lt;STRONG&gt;prob=&lt;/STRONG&gt; in the &lt;STRONG&gt;output&lt;/STRONG&gt; statement to compute those probabilities.&lt;/P&gt;</description>

      <description>&lt;P&gt;I'd say that your code is doing exactly what you've specified: you've specified an intercept-only model, so predictions for all observations will be equal to the intercept.&lt;/P&gt;
